That's because brazilian doctors are not alowed to post before and after pictures, by the law.
So just to clarify you guys, he charges R$5 reais per graft and the average rate is 1 dollar = 2.20 reais... So you can get a hair transplantation of 4000 grafts for something like $8.700 - 9.000 dollars.
And yes, he is a very good doctor, and he performs 4000+ larges secctions too.
